/*!
* Copyright 2022-2023 XGBoost contributors
*/
syntax = "proto3";
package xgboost.collective.federated;
service Federated {
rpc Allgather(AllgatherRequest) returns (AllgatherReply) {}
rpc AllgatherV(AllgatherVRequest) returns (AllgatherVReply) {}
rpc Allreduce(AllreduceRequest) returns (AllreduceReply) {}
rpc Broadcast(BroadcastRequest) returns (BroadcastReply) {}
}
enum DataType {
HALF = 0;
FLOAT = 1;
DOUBLE = 2;
LONG_DOUBLE = 3;
INT8 = 4;
INT16 = 5;
INT32 = 6;
INT64 = 7;
UINT8 = 8;
UINT16 = 9;
UINT32 = 10;
UINT64 = 11;
}
enum ReduceOperation {
MAX = 0;
MIN = 1;
SUM = 2;
BITWISE_AND = 3;
BITWISE_OR = 4;
BITWISE_XOR = 5;
}
message AllgatherRequest {
// An incrementing counter that is unique to each round to operations.
uint64 sequence_number = 1;
int32 rank = 2;
bytes send_buffer = 3;
}
message AllgatherReply {
bytes receive_buffer = 1;
}
message AllgatherVRequest {
// An incrementing counter that is unique to each round to operations.
uint64 sequence_number = 1;
int32 rank = 2;
bytes send_buffer = 3;
}
message AllgatherVReply {
bytes receive_buffer = 1;
}
message AllreduceRequest {
// An incrementing counter that is unique to each round to operations.
uint64 sequence_number = 1;
int32 rank = 2;
bytes send_buffer = 3;
DataType data_type = 4;
ReduceOperation reduce_operation = 5;
}
message AllreduceReply {
bytes receive_buffer = 1;
}
message BroadcastRequest {
// An incrementing counter that is unique to each round to operations.
uint64 sequence_number = 1;
int32 rank = 2;
bytes send_buffer = 3;
// The root rank to broadcast from.
int32 root = 4;
}
message BroadcastReply {
bytes receive_buffer = 1;
}
